Transaction e0fb90a4cc15be778d8ab7d5c661ffc111a2df595cfbe254624479a507539c1f
1 Input
1 Output
-
e0fb90a4cc15be778d8ab7d5c661ffc111a2df595cfbe254624479a507539c1f:0
- value
- 1506992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19bd910d8c1cc3b0a43e1b2d2441885d08a09dae OP_EQUAL
- address
- 3437ufA6MCJ3v4MYaiZmA595to7bRq4w1D